Checking your credit score often doesn't affect it but here's what you should keep in mind Although soft inquiry doesn't impact the credit score, the hard inquiry - on the other hand - can have a minor negative impact. This happens when a lender checks your credit report for a loan application.

Credit score: How long does negative information stay for on your CIBIL report? MintGenie answers Late payments can remain on your CIBIL report for up to seven years from the date of the first missed payment.
